Why does IPV6 use separate extension headers? Explain.
The extension headers in Ipv6 are utilized for economy and extensibility. Partitioning the datagram functionality in separation headers is economical since this saves space. Also containing separate headers in Ipv6 creates this possible to describe large set of features without needing each datagram header to contain at least one field for all features.
Extensibility comes in existence while new features are needed to be added to a protocol. Protocol as Ipv4 requires complete change, the header should be redesigned to accommodate new features. However in Ipv6, existing protocol header keeps unchanged. A new header field can be explained to accommodate new change.
